The former Melbourne Victory and Brisbane Roar goal machine is now a free agent.

He exited Sanfrecce Hiroshima overnight a year and a month after signing for the club.

Berisha, 34, never cemented a place at the club but was on a lucrative contract and was expected to see out the year. 

However, he was a peripheral figure for the club, making just six appearances off the bench last season.

This season, he was not sighted at all.

The striker’s representatives in Australia spoke briefly to FTBL today, and they appear to have been taken by surprise by the move.

At this point, the forward’s future is unclear.

There’s little doubt that there’d be one or two club A-League clubs eyeing the situation, especially as the striker is now an Australian citizen.

However Berisha could move back to Germany where he played before moving to Australia, lured by Ange Postecoglou’s vision for Brisbane Roar in 2011.

But a move back to Brisbane could be possible under Robbie Fowler. 

Likewise new boys Western United, the Jets, and Western Sydney Wanderers may be interested given their current squad rosters.
